Brandon Baun

Brandon earned a Master of Science degree in Applied Developmental Psychology with a specialization in Research Methodology from the University of Pittsburgh. During this time, Brandon worked as a researcher in the Mindfulness & Self-Regulation Lab where he helped lead the development of a smartphone-based mindfulness intervention for adolescents. Brandon is also a musician, composer, audio engineer, and painter who has a passion for utilizing mindfulness in his creative practice.

Interview with Blake Colaianne

Blake Colaianne is a former Earth science teacher turned contemplative researcher. He is currently a Ph.D. Candidate in Human Development and Family Studies at Penn State University. His research focuses on supporting adolescent development using both a culture of belonging in high schools and prevention and promotion programs that teach mindfulness and compassion skills.
